Exploring the Spectrum: A Comparison of Watercolor Types
Watercolor enthusiasts are always looking for the perfect shade to bring their vision to life. But with so many different types of watercolor available, choosing the right one can be tricky. From traditional tubes to modern fluid formulas, each type offers its own unique set of properties.
Traditional watercolors come in convenient pans or convenient tubes. They offer a classic feel and are perfect for novices who are just starting their watercolor journey. Granulated watercolors, on the other hand, create dimensional effects with their pockmarked pigments, adding a visually appealing touch to artwork. Fluid watercolors, as their name suggests, are known for their velvety consistency, allowing for seamless blends and washes.
Heavy-body watercolors, though, provide more intensity and are ideal for creating vibrant artwork. Each type of watercolor has its own strengths, making it important to experiment different options to find the perfect fit for your artistic style.
